Overview

Kensington Palace, a palace influenced by generations of royal women and holds intriguing secret stories of the public lives who lived within its walls. Explore the magnificent state apartments and discover the story of Queen Caroline, the wife of George II, and her keen interests in the arts and sciences. Marvel at the magnificent artworks from the Royal Collection and the elegant 18th century decoration.
Birthplace of Queen Victoria, visit the rooms in which she was born and grew up. Victoria; a Royal Childhood, tells the tale of her hobbies, interests and education.
Explore the intimate relationship between fashion designer and royal client and view Diana, Princess of Wales's wedding dress in Royal Style in the Making exhibition, open from 3 June - 2 January 2022

What To Expect

Kensington Palace
Kensington Palace unveils a palace of secret stories and public lives. Arrive through stunning landscaped gardens and be greeted by a statue of one of Kensington Palace’s most famous residents, Queen Victoria. Walk in the footsteps of Kings and Queens as you venture through the elegant state apartments. Filled with stories of two royal courts; the Stuarts and the Hanoverians, step back in time as you discover what you would have worn, how you would have had to behave and how to navigate the heady atmosphere of court at Kensington Palace.

Victoria – A royal childhood. Most are aware of the “unamused” older Queen Victoria, however through a display of objects relating to her early years, you will gain an intimate insight into the world of the creative and vibrant princess destined to rule over the greatest empire the world had ever seen. All within the permanent representation of Victoria’s childhood rooms, discover the princess’s education, family life, friendships and bitter struggles during her life under the strict “Kensington System”.

Emeralds (and diamonds) are a girl’s best friend! Don’t miss out on the chance to marvel at the breath-taking Tiaras commissioned for Victoria by her husband, Prince Albert. Featuring the magnificent diamond and emerald diadem, emerald neckless, earrings and brooch, this display is a true testament to the pure love Albert had for his wife.

Victoria – Woman and crown is a new exhibition in the Pigott Galleries uncovering the private woman behind the throne and re-examines her later life and legacy. Included in this exhibition are rare survivals from Victoria’s private wardrobe including a fashionable pari of silver boots. This intriguing story also reveals how her 9 children and 42 grandchildren extended her influence across Europe and the Empire. This exhibition will close 5 January 2020.

Palace Gardens – the beautiful gardens connect the palace with the landscape of the wider Kensington Gardens providing picturesque vistas. You will also be able to see the beautiful sunken garden, one of Princess Diana’s favourite spots and where Prince Harry and Meghan Markle posed for their engagement photos. Garden history tours are available in the summer months but hurry as places are on a first come first served basis!
